ANASTASIA: THE MUSICAL Auditions:
 
November 2 & 3, 2021 at 6pm
 
Auditions will take place in the Dunlap High School auditorium. Please prepare a song to sing (preferably not from this show), and dress in comfortable clothing for a dance audition. 
 
Arrive on time for your audition and be prepared with a list of your conflicts during rehearsals from Nov. 8 – Jan. 23. Rehearsals will be Monday thru Friday evenings from 6-8pm and some Sunday afternoons from 1-3pm.
Performances will be January 21, 22, and 23, 2022.
 
From Tony winners Terrance McNally, Stephen Flaherty, and Lynn Ahrens, creators of such Broadway classics as Ragtime and Once On This Island, this dazzling show transports its audience from the twilight of the Russian Empire to the euphoria of Paris in the 1920s as a brave young woman sets out to discover the mystery of her past. Pursued by the ruthless Soviet officer determined to silence her, Anya enlists the aid of a dashing con man and a loveable ex-aristocrat. Together, they embark on an epic adventure to help her find home, love, and family.

Character Breakdown:
 
Anya/Anastasia:
When we first meet Anya she is a lost soul but with great strength, pride, determination, and dignity; as the story progresses, she begins to discover her sense of self and the possibility that she may be the missing daughter of Tsar Nicholas; not looking for a fairy tale princess; when Anya is transformed into the beautiful Anastasia it should have the same effect and surprise as Eliza Doolittle entering the ball
Vocal part: soprano with belt range
Vocal range: A3-Eb4
 
Dowager Empress:
The formidable and imperious grandmother of Anastasia; Anastasia is her favorite grandchild and she loves her with all her heart; she never truly gives up the belief that her granddaughter might be alive, but finally after years of enduring Anastasia pretenders she becomes hardened and bitter; it is only when she meets Anya that her old spirit begins to return; even when she knows that Anya may not be Anastasia, she realizes that we all need our dreams and we need the truth; actress must have elegance, beauty, and a regal bearing
Vocal part: alto
Vocal range: F3-Bb4
 
Dmitry:
An opportunist trying to make it on the streets of Russia by selling stolen objects from the Tsarist past; he is the prince of St. Petersburg’s black market; he creates the scheme to find an Anastasia impersonator in order to gain the reward for her safe return; he is smooth, persuasive, and a real operator; must have a sense of danger, edginess, and charisma; not a typical romantic leaving man, although he and Anya eventually fall in love.
Vocal part: baritenor
Vocal range: A2-G4
 
Vlad Popov:
Before the revolution Vlad was a minor functionary at the imperial court; he’s Dmitry’s right-hand man and because of his romantic relationship with Lily he arranges a meeting between Anya and the Dowager Empress; actor must have wit, style, and be a character comedian with panache.
Vocal part: baritone
Vocal range: A2-F4
 
Gleb:
A member of the Chekist secret police, a zealot with tremendous intensity and a dangerous desirability; as the play progresses, we see him rise in power and position within the political party; he is in love with Anya but would not be above killing her if necessary.
Vocal part: baritone
Vocal range: A2-Gb4
 
Countess Lily Malevsky-Malevitch:
The voluptuous confidante/lady-in-waiting to the Dowager Empress. She’s delightful when she’s not with the Dowager but also compassionate, respectful, and good at her job. She doesn’t take her romantic relationship with Vlad too seriously. Must be a juicy character comedienne with strong physicality.
Vocal part: Mezzo Soprano
 
Supporting Roles:
Tsarina Alexandra, Isadora Duncan, Hotel Manager, Swan Lake ballet dancers, Coco Chanel, Tsar Nicholas II, Gertrude Stein, Pablo Picasso, Ernest Hemingway, and others.
 
Ensemble: A medium-sized ensemble will fill the various supporting roles, as well as play Russian and Parisian citizens.
